Nippersink Fishing
Nippersink, Round Lake
13 acres | max depth: 17 feet
Man-made in 1965, extensive shoreline restoration efforts and improved fish habitats make Nippersink's two lakes great for fishing. Anglers can fish from shore or from two handicap-accessible fishing piers.
Note: Catch-and-release fishing is mandatory at this site. This program makes it recreation for anglers and beneficial for nature. Anglers are encouraged to use barbless, non-stainless steel hooks.
Directions
Located in west central Lake County in Round Lake. The entrance is located on Belvidere Road (Route 120), just west of Cedar Lake Road, east of Fairfield Road.
